About

Salvatore "Totò" Schillaci is a former Italian professional footballer who played as a striker. He is best known for his unexpected success at the 1990 FIFA World Cup, where he won the Golden Boot as the tournament's top scorer. Schillaci played for several clubs during his career, including Messina, Juventus, Internazionale, and Júbilo Iwata in Japan. His performances in the 1990 World Cup remain the highlight of his career.
